Why is there confusion between KB and KiB, MB and MiB, etc.?
Historically, "kilobyte" (KB) was often used informally to mean 1024 bytes (2^10). However, the SI prefix "kilo" officially means 1000 (10^3). This led to confusion. The IEC introduced binary prefixes like kibibyte (KiB) specifically for 1024 bytes, mebibyte (MiB) for 1024 KiB, etc., to provide clarity. SI prefixes (kB, MB, GB) are now correctly used for powers of 1000, while IEC prefixes (KiB, MiB, GiB) are used for powers of 1024.
What is the difference between bits and bytes?
A bit is the smallest unit of data, representing a binary value of either 0 or 1. A byte is a common unit of digital information that consists of 8 bits. Data storage capacity is typically measured in bytes and their larger multiples.
